About Gaston Castano

Cristian Gastón Castaño (born June 8, 1985) is an Argentine professional footballer. Although primarily known as a striker for various clubs in the Indonesian League, including PSS Sleman, PSIS Semarang, and Pelita Bandung Raya, he gained significant prominence in Indonesia's entertainment industry due to his high-profile relationship and marriage to the late actress and singer, Julia Perez.
